加入收藏 | 设为首页 | 会员中心 | 我要投稿 92站长网 (https://www.92zhanzhang.com/)- 视觉智能、智能语音交互、边缘计算、物联网、开发!
当前位置: 首页 > 综合聚焦 > 资源网站 > 空间 > 正文

Go空间节点资源深度剖析与高效部署全攻略

发布时间:2026-04-23 09:06:38 所属栏目:空间 来源:DaWei
导读:  Go语言在构建高性能、高并发的后端服务方面表现出色,而空间节点资源的合理配置和高效部署是确保系统稳定运行的关键。理解并优化这些资源,能够显著提升应用性能和用户体验。  空间节点通常指的是分布式系统中

  Go语言在构建高性能、高并发的后端服务方面表现出色,而空间节点资源的合理配置和高效部署是确保系统稳定运行的关键。理解并优化这些资源,能够显著提升应用性能和用户体验。


  空间节点通常指的是分布式系统中承载业务逻辑的服务器或虚拟机实例。每个节点的CPU、内存、存储和网络带宽等资源直接影响服务的响应速度和吞吐量。在部署Go应用时,需要根据实际负载情况合理分配这些资源。


  对于Go应用而言,其并发模型基于goroutine,因此对CPU核心数和线程调度有较高要求。建议为每个节点配置至少与核心数相匹配的线程池,以充分利用多核优势,避免资源浪费。


  内存管理也是关键因素之一。Go的垃圾回收机制虽然高效,但频繁的GC会影响性能。通过合理设置GOMAXPROCS和调整GC参数,可以优化内存使用效率,减少延迟。


AI渲染图,仅供参考

  存储方面,建议采用SSD以提高I/O性能,尤其是在处理大量数据读写时。同时,合理规划缓存策略,如使用Redis或本地缓存,能有效降低数据库压力,提升整体响应速度。


  网络配置同样不可忽视。确保节点间的通信延迟低,可以通过优化DNS解析、使用TCP Keep-Alive以及合理配置负载均衡器来实现。监控网络流量变化,有助于及时发现潜在瓶颈。


  在部署过程中,自动化工具如Docker和Kubernetes可以大幅简化流程,提高部署效率。利用容器化技术,不仅便于版本控制,还能实现快速扩展和回滚。


  持续监控和调优是保持系统高效运行的必要手段。通过日志分析、性能指标收集和A/B测试,可以不断优化资源配置,适应业务增长和技术演进。

(编辑:92站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章